King Maha Vajiralongkorn and Queen Suthida of Thailand have tested positive for covid-19, the royal palace said in a statement on Saturday. The 70-year-old ruler and his 44-year-old spouse have “mild symptoms,” the palace added in the statement.

As the Thai royals become the latest to test positive for the virus, here’s a look at which royals around the world have contracted Covid-19:

1. The late Queen Elizabeth

Britain’s longest-serving monarch had tested positive for the virus in February, and Buckingham Palace said at the time that he had three vaccinations and had “mild cold-like symptoms.” He passed away on September 8 due to “old age”.

2. King Charles III

The then prince, and now the monarch of Great Britain, King Charles III had tested positive for covid-19 in February of this year. It was the second time the virus had attacked him after he caught it in March 2020.

3. Camilla, Queen Consort of Great Britain

Camilla, then Duchess of Cornwall, had also fallen ill with Covid-19 in February this year. At the time, it was reported that both she and Charles received booster shots. She had called herself “fortunately” negative, according to Sky News, after being tested multiple times.

4. Queen Margrethe II of Denmark

Queen Margarita, who this year celebrated 50 years of her monarchy, tested positive for covid-19 in February, almost at the same time as King Carlos III. Her office had said at the time that the 81-year-old monarch was displaying only mild symptoms.

5. King Philip of Spain

The Spanish King had also tested positive for Covid-19 in February this year after presenting “mild symptoms”, his office said at the time. It was also reported that at that time, his wife, Queen Letizia, and his daughters, Princess Leonor and Princess Sofía, did not present any symptoms and continued with their normal activities.

6. King and Queen of Sweden

Swedish King Carl XVI Gustaf and Queen Silvia tested positive for covid-19 in January this year, the Swedish Royal Court said in a statement. It added that both royals were displaying “mild symptoms”, was isolating at home and had been vaccinated with three injections of the Covid-19 vaccine.
